Comment:
 Why doesn't ten minutes suit you? Why does 30 minutes work? To what usage
 are you putting this feature that requires a (possibly variable) delay?
 The intent of this feature as designed was (largely) to prevent people
 from getting log files consisting entirely of "Bye." when they closed
 their window too early. It additionally means that should a conversation
 end, and within short order need to be restarted the previous history will
 be retained for some small amount of time. For periods longer then that
 the History plugin works to retrieve older history from conversation logs.
 I feel ten minutes is reasonable because it (wildly) more than adequately
 handles the "Bye." case and provides a fairly reasonable approximation to
 the amount of time I think a conversation stands to be resurrected during.
 I would be equally happy with 5 or 15 minutes and personally I do not even
 use this feature.
 Adding preferences is something we do carefully as we already have quite a
 few and they add cost to maintenance so we try to make sure they are
 really necessary before doing so.
